The NBAA membership directory has a full list of companies, aircraft, contact info, and locations of each member. They are arranged in a number of different ways with geographic and aphebetical to name two. If you know anyone that is an active NBAA member, they might be able to let you borrow this publication. I believe that you need a password to access this info online. There are some aviation consulting firms that have these publications as they are members themselves. You could also look up by state the aeronautics divisions for aircraft listings however be aware that Deleware and Oregon both have many companies listed that actually do not spend much time there.
